Everytime I'm playing a game with DosBox and push Alt-Enter to go into fullscreen, the game crashes. Though I can still play the games, it can get frustrating after a while with just the little screen. Any ideas? :crazy:

How about editing the dosbox.conf file (open it with notepad etc) with the following:

Find fullscreen=false change it to fullscreen=true

That way it should always start in fullscreen and hopefully not freeze... k:
